什么是虚拟币钱包?

        虚拟币钱包是一种用于存储、管理和交易加密货币的数字钱包。虚拟币钱包实际上是一个存储加密货币私钥的软件程序,它允许用户发送和接收加密货币,并查看其余额。

        为什么要自己做一个虚拟币钱包?

        自己做一个虚拟币钱包可以增加对加密货币的控制权和安全性。通过自己开发或使用开源钱包软件,您可以避免依赖第三方钱包提供商,并确保私钥的安全性。此外,自己做一个钱包也可以提供更多的自定义和功能扩展。

        如何自己做一个虚拟币钱包?

        要自己做一个虚拟币钱包,需要以下步骤:

        1. 学习区块链和加密货币的基本知识

        了解区块链技术的工作原理、加密货币的基本概念和机制对于开发一个安全可靠的钱包至关重要。

        2. 选择适合的开发平台和语言

        根据您的技术背景和偏好,选择一个适合的开发平台和编程语言。常用的开发平台包括Web、移动应用开发和桌面应用开发。

        3. 设计钱包的用户界面

        设计一个简洁、易用和用户友好的钱包界面,使用户能够轻松管理和交易加密货币。

        4. 实现钱包的核心功能

        核心功能包括生成加密货币地址、实现转账功能、管理用户余额和交易历史等。

        5. 安全性考虑

        确保私钥的安全性是开发虚拟币钱包时的重要任务。使用加密算法保护私钥,定期备份和加密私钥,以及采用多重身份验证等都是增加安全性的方法。

        6. 进行测试和

        在发布之前,进行详尽的测试和,确保钱包的稳定性和功能完整性。

        7. 上线和推广

        一旦完成开发和测试,将钱包上线并进行推广,使更多人使用您的虚拟币钱包。

        虚拟币钱包需要考虑哪些安全性问题?

        在开发虚拟币钱包时,需要重视以下安全性

        1. 私钥安全

        私钥是访问和控制加密货币的关键,需要使用强密码保护私钥,并将其保存在安全的环境中,同时定期备份和加密私钥。

        2. 防止恶意软件和网络攻击

        需要通过安全的软件开发实践和网络安全措施来防止恶意软件和网络攻击,如使用最新的安全更新、加密通信和防火墙。

        3. 多重身份验证

        为了增加用户账户的安全性,可以实施多重身份验证机制,例如使用短信验证码、谷歌验证器或生物识别技术。

        4. 安全审计

        定期对钱包进行安全审计,以识别潜在的安全漏洞和风险,并及时修复和改进。

        使用开源钱包软件还是自己开发钱包?

        使用开源钱包软件还是自己开发钱包取决于您的需求和技术能力。使用开源钱包软件可以节省时间和精力,并且能够从开源社区的贡献中受益。然而,自己开发钱包可以更好地控制钱包的安全性和功能扩展。

        虚拟币钱包的未来发展趋势是什么?

        虚拟币钱包领域的未来发展趋势包括:

        1. 支持多种加密货币

        未来的虚拟币钱包将支持更多种类的加密货币,以满足用户的多样化需求。

        2. 整合更多的服务

        虚拟币钱包可能会整合更多的服务,如购物、支付、投资等,以提供更便捷的用户体验。

        3. 安全性

        钱包开发者将继续钱包的安全性,采用更加先进的技术来保护用户的资金安全。

        4. 增强用户隐私

        钱包开发者会致力于提供更强的用户隐私保护机制,保障用户的个人信息和交易数据的安全。

        通过以上步骤和问题的介绍,您可以了解如何自己做一个虚拟币钱包,并了解相关的关键词和问题。请注意,每个问题的详细介绍应包含至少,并使用相应的HTML标签进行分段和标题。